3

これに対する答えを見つけることができませんでした。たとえば、配列があるとします:

var myArray = ["a","b","c","d","e","f","g"]; // pretend I define up to 1000 elements

配列を反復処理する 1 つの簡単な方法は次のとおりです。

for(var i=0; i<myArray.length; i++){
    console.log(myArray[i]);
}

私が把握しようとしているのは、.length プロパティが反復ごとに評価されるかどうかです。

my len = myArray.length;
for(var i=0; i<len i++){
    console.log(myArray[i]);
}

2番目のアプローチはパフォーマンスの向上になりますか? エンジンは反復ごとJSに を計算しますか?length

4

2 に答える 2